tesseract.js is a JavaScript library that provides Optical Character Recognition (OCR) capabilities for more than 100 languages. It allows developers to extract text from images and scanned documents in a variety of languages, making it a useful tool for applications that require text recognition. The library is designed to be easy to use and integrate into web applications, and it can be used for a wide range of tasks, from simple text extraction to more complex document analysis.
Umi-OCR is an Optical Character Recognition (OCR) software that uses artificial intelligence to recognize and extract text from various file formats, including images and scanned documents. It supports multiple languages and provides high accuracy in text recognition.
